Output e0602a949172702d386b0f31f1152605f1f1bfd7ab55ed522f1b51cd01a6e973:14

value
3592458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 105d1bbe9c939d6975644a1d6753a26e4ddf8cba OP_EQUAL
address
33BYGtx6mqgBBgpmGzLv639dF5i7cFzSrp
transaction
e0602a949172702d386b0f31f1152605f1f1bfd7ab55ed522f1b51cd01a6e973
spent
true